Transaction 106edc8302934931aabd90017659d59be6e1955f6bc46c721b8b02577b45f7b6
1 Input
1 Output
-
106edc8302934931aabd90017659d59be6e1955f6bc46c721b8b02577b45f7b6:0
- value
- 999090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4b838bc2c67f05c24903dbd0e6c700dde0a5c0d OP_EQUAL
- address
- 3M5ms9upTFQ4G9VYXBUkSc81yckaWsEJmm